The very first product to come from our joint efforts is a “Line Tester”. The Line Tester, known as the “SGS backStage LineTester”, solves the age old problems of failed phone lines in a central station. The product is a Linux appliance that sits on your network and connects to outbound POTS phone lines. On a periodic basis, it places automated calls to each of your inbound phone lines, and reports the results. For any Contact ID receiver, it can act as a panel and send a test signal to the receiver that is pushed all the way through to automation. When failures are detected, they are recorded and visible through the unique user interface as well as sent to automation as line failures/restores of a genericSur-Gard receiver. The product is based on LAMP (Linux, Apache, MySQL, PHP), and runs on hardware that is near solid state. In the meantime we continued our efforts on our Dispatch Automation software product, Stages. Stages, set to launch in Q1 of 2008, already caught the attention of several companies interested in the next generation of Dispatch software. A modular approach has been taken, isolating the responsibilities for database interaction, user presentation, workflow management, and rules enforcement. Each module has a specific function, and can be upgraded independent of the others. Likewise, external modules to provide inbound and outbound interfaces (receivers, IVR, telephony, etc) are being developed, many as appliances specific to their task.
The tool set being developed for Stages is very unique, and as I mentioned before, is best of breed. The database foundation is Microsoft SQL, a proven platform for performance and reliability. The database has been designed from the ground up, and includes XML web services that will let customers access the data in an open standard never before available across an entire automation database. The primary development environment utilizes C#.NET, JavaScript, AJAX techniques, Web Services, and SQL Stored Procedures. The result is a browser-based experience that you have never experienced before. There are no plug-ins, no ActiveX controls, and it is cross-browser and cross-platform compliant.
